The Helia Resource Center endeavors to serve a multi-dimensional purpose on Wall Street. The concept requires a degree of imagination to peer into the realm of lasting truths and enduring values. Helia commits to establish a higher ethical standard in doing business and focus in the pursuit of social goals/ and equality. The Helia invites you to participate.

 

Our mission is to provide funding to designated recipients/projects in pursuit of social responsible projects. The SRI is designed to increase wealth to socially disadvantaged in today's corporate society. The aim is to also provide income for artists/craftsmen themselves .

The combination of art and finance is a powerful force to demonstrate awareness and participation in global social responsibility investments (SRI). 

A portion of each proceeds of every piece of artwork/craft sold will go towards developing  the capital base to operate the SRI fund. 

The overall objective is to create wealth. SRI believes something needs to be done to cut down the huge wealth gap. SRI seeks to make investments in areas where people face disparities.
